Common Name: Silver Philodendron, Silver Satin Pothos, Scindapsus Pictus
Scientific Name: Scindapsus pictus 'Argyraeus'

Soil Depth: Moderate to Deep
Lighting: All Light Levels
Humidity & Misting: 40%-100% , Can tolerate <40% / Suggested for optimal growth
Mature Plant Size & Root System: This very fast growing plant will form vines that will creep and climb wherever it can! If allowed to climb, the leaves will "shingle" and grow flush to the surface! Vigorous root system will burrow deep and/or form aerial roots to cling to surfaces in high humidity environments
Temperature Tolerance & Placement in the Terrarium: Too high temperatures/low humidity may cause leaves to brown / Back/Wall planting or groundcover if maintained low
Edible & Side Effects if Ingested: Scindapsus are members of the Family Araceae so they contain low levels of oxalic acid and sharp calcium oxalate crystals known as raphides. Ingestion is not recommended and may cause oral irritation
